Meghan Markle - photo #725

Meghan Markle, photo #1038681
Meghan Markle pic #1038680 2165x1536
Meghan Markle pic #1038681 2400x1800
Meghan Markle pic #1038682 3500x2335

Meghan Markle photo #1038681 (725 of 1853)
Added: 2018-05-20 00:00:00
Size: 2400x1800 px (0 Kb)

More Meghan Markle photos

Meghan Markle pic #1114756 962x1502
Meghan Markle pic #1038464 1140x779
Meghan Markle pic #1103056 962x1261
Meghan Markle pic #1180169 962x1446